The C8 generation marks the first time the RS6 Avant is available in the U.S. market. Sharing its architecture with luxury models like the Lamborghini Urus and Bentley Continental, it combines luxury and performance seamlessly.

Known issues by generation

While the C8 RS6 Avant is known for its exceptional engineering, it is important to note some model-specific issues. The EA825 4.0L twin-turbo V8 engine can experience heat-soak and turbocharger oil line wear. The 48V mild-hybrid system, while innovative, may require significant preventive maintenance like the belt-alternator-starter service. Additionally, high-mileage vehicles might see wear in the 8-speed Tiptronic automatic transmission and its torque-vectoring differentials. Owners should also be aware of potential MMI infotainment screen glitches and the necessity of regular AdBlue (DEF) tank refills for emissions compliance.

Is a qualified appraisal necessary for donation?
Yes, for donations valued at $5,000 or more, a qualified appraisal is required to complete IRS Form 8283 Section B. This helps determine the fair market value.
